In the Beginning

"In the beginning, God created the heavens and the earth. The earth was formless and empty, and darkness covered the deep waters. And the Spirit of God was hovering over the surface of the waters." (Genesis 1:1-2)

Being a science major and a Christian has its sticky situations, especially when it comes to the topic of evolution. Yet, I believe that the Christian view of how the earth was created is not in conflict with science, rather it is in conflict with the idea of how the universe started without a creator.

Everything that was created came from a creator. God is the creator. The Bible doesn't describe exactly every detail of how the earth came into place, which is ok because if we focused so much on that, then we loose the whole purpose of this statement, which is the origin of the creation. The world did not just appear by chance; God created it. The Bible not only tells us who created it, but most importantly it tells us who God is. Through His work and creation, we see God's personality, His character, His plan for His creation, and His deepest desire: To fellowship with us all.

So to say that the earth just happened or evolved actually requires more faith than to believe that God is the one who did it all. And God did not have to create the universe, yet he chose to. He chose to because He loves us, and He expresses His love by creating the universe and us.

Through God's creation, we see that He is organized in a way that He creates things in order. And when His work was done, God rested. As the creator, He is very creative and in control of everything. We also learn that as people, we are all valuable to Him because He chose to create us and He put us above any of His other creations. And by that, He made us rulers over the earth and the animals. We also see through His work God's power, as He SPOKE everything into existence!

Well if God created everything, then who created God? To ask this question is to assume there was another creator before God. But God is the infinite being who has always been and who was created by no one. This is difficult to understand because finite minds cannot comprehend the infinite. It is like trying to think of the highest number, which is impossible. Therefore, we shouldn't limit our infinite God to our finite understanding.

Know God, Know Love. No God, No Love!

"I have loved you even as the Father has loved me. Remain in my love. When you obey my commandments, you remain in my love, just as I obey my Father's commandments and remain in his love. I have told you these things so that you will be filled with joy. Yes, your joy will overflow! This is my commandment: Love each other in the same way I have loved you. There is no greater love than to lay down one's life for one's friends." - John 15: 9-13

To remain in God's love is to STAY in His love, CONTINUE in His love without changing, BE LEFT in His love after everything else has gone, WORK in His love as more is required to be done, and ENDURE in His love by continuing on in spite of everything else. Jesus doesn't want us to just receive His love, but REMAIN in it. We know what love is because we know God. We love because He first loved us. Jesus wants us to love one another the way He loves us, for He loved us enough to give His life for us. We may not have to die for someone, but there are other ways to practice sacrificial love for others. Since we know God, we know His love. Without God, there is not love.

Sometimes, its not easy to love others the way God loves us. But knowing this reminds me that despite of the situation, I must love others anyways. There may be people who hurt me but I need to love them because I know I've hurt God sometimes and He still loves me. I'm not perfect, but God still loves me, just like others are not perfect, so I should still love them too. It's easy to love those who are nice and love you too, but what about those who are not so easy to love? Does that mean we give up and don't try to love them? I think God is challenging all of us daily to truly love on others, especially those who are hard to love. Our act of love and kindness could be their first witness of God and His love. Just like Jesus, we can show love in many different ways: listening, helping, encouraging, giving, etc. We tell people I love them, but do our actions really show it?
